Overview

Adil H. Haider is affiliated with Brigham and Women's Hospital in the United States and has a substantial body of research within the medical field, particularly focused on trauma and emergency care.

Their recent publications include studies on various aspects of trauma and surgical research. Notable papers include:

  • Gunshot Injuries in American Trauma Centers: Analysis of the Lethality of Multiple Gunshot Wounds (2020), published in The American Surgeon
  • The National Burden of Orthopedic Injury: Cross-Sectional Estimates for Trauma System Planning and Optimization (2020), published in Journal of Surgical Research
  • Proceedings from the Consensus Conference on Trauma Patient-Reported Outcome Measures (2020), published in Journal of the American College of Surgeons
  • Association of Trauma Center Designation With Postdischarge Survival Among Older Adults With Injuries (2022), published in JAMA Network Open
  • A Multistate Study of Race and Ethnic Disparities in Access to Trauma Care (2020), published in Journal of Surgical Research
